The invention relates to the technical field of pipe intelligent locks, and discloses a semi-automatic intelligent lock. The semi-automatic intelligent lock comprises a lock body, a lock cylinder anda lock shaft, wherein the lock body is in an inverted-T shape, identical grooves are symmetrically formed in protruding parts of the left side and the right side of the lock body, the two ends of thelock shaft are arranged in the grooves of the lock body respectively, an opening of the lock cylinder is Y-shaped, an auxiliary unlocking device is arranged in the lock cylinder, the auxiliary unlocking device is located on the lower half portion in the lock cylinder, the auxiliary unlocking device comprises four movable blocks, and the movable blocks are arranged on the left side and the right side in the lock cylinder in pairs. According to the semi-automatic intelligent lock, the auxiliary unlocking device is arranged for using in a mode of cooperating with a common unlocking device and a special unlocking device, a user can directly insert a key into the lock cylinder and then press the key downwards in an emergency, and at the moment, the key can be temporarily clamped due to the movable blocks so that the user can unlock the lock body more quickly, and the user can also unlock the lock body quickly in the emergency.
